Roughly 4 to 10. The 4×4 grid is approachable for early-readers; the 8×8 grid will stretch confident solvers.
No. The puzzles use pictures, so number-recognition isn't a prerequisite. The logic of sudoku — "each row, column, and box uses every symbol exactly once" — is what they learn.
SudokuSaurus is a paid one-time download with no in-app purchases, no subscriptions, and no ads. You pay once and get everything, forever.
None. The app does not collect, transmit, or store any personal data. The only thing saved is your last grid size, last difficulty, and chosen theme — all on-device.
Yes. SudokuSaurus is universal — the same app runs on iPhone and iPad with layouts tuned for each.
